Description Diane Sawyer is the current co host of Good Morning America. She has been in front of the cameras since 1978 starting her TV journalist career with CBS Morning News. Since then she became a correspondent and co anchor of 60 minutes. She moved to ABC network to Co anchor Primetime live in 1989. She joined Good Morning America in 1999 to co host with Charles Gibson and ratings of the program improved ever since. Before becoming a TV personality, Diane worked in the Nixon administration then helped him write his memoirs after his impeachment. Diane was born in 1945 in Glasgow Kentucky. She received her degree in English from Wellesley College. She is married to director Mike Nichols. She has received numerous awards in her TV career including nine Enmmys, two Peabody Awards.
